Khleo Posté 21 Avril 2008 Partager Posté 21 Avril 2008 Salut, Je voudrais savoir si il existé une technique spécial pour copier une base de données MySQL d'environ 50 Mo ou si il fallait la fragmenter en plusieurs petit fichiers SQL de 1 Mo ? Merci Lien vers le commentaire Partager sur d’autres sites More sharing options...
Dadou Posté 21 Avril 2008 Partager Posté 21 Avril 2008 Cela dépend de la config serveur, mais en général, c'est bien mieux de couper en petits bout les fichiers Lien vers le commentaire Partager sur d’autres sites More sharing options...
Dan Posté 21 Avril 2008 Partager Posté 21 Avril 2008 Tout dépend si tu as accès au shell Linux ou non. Es-tu sur serveur dédié ou sur mutualisé ? Lien vers le commentaire Partager sur d’autres sites More sharing options...
cognotte Posté 21 Avril 2008 Partager Posté 21 Avril 2008 La réponse m'interesse aussi Dan, je doit copier une grosse base d'un dédié a un autre (j'ai acces au shell des 2 machines) Lien vers le commentaire Partager sur d’autres sites More sharing options...
Leonick Posté 21 Avril 2008 Partager Posté 21 Avril 2008 le mieux étant d'utiliser mysqldump en ligne de commande http://dev.mysql.com/doc/refman/5.0/fr/mysqldump.html Lien vers le commentaire Partager sur d’autres sites More sharing options...
Khleo Posté 21 Avril 2008 Auteur Partager Posté 21 Avril 2008 Tout dépend si tu as accès au shell Linux ou non.Es-tu sur serveur dédié ou sur mutualisé ? Non, j'ai pas de base de données à transférer pour le moment, c'est juste une question au cas ou le problème se présenterait Merci Lien vers le commentaire Partager sur d’autres sites More sharing options...
Dan Posté 21 Avril 2008 Partager Posté 21 Avril 2008 La réponse m'interesse aussi Dan, je doit copier une grosse base d'un dédié a un autre (j'ai acces au shell des 2 machines) Tu peux facilement exporter la base avec mysqldump comme ceci mysqldump -uUSER -pPASSWORD -e -q -Q --add-drop-table BASE_DE_DONNEES | gzip > NOM_DE_BASE.sql.gz ensuite tu copies le fichier sql.gz par ftp ou rsync/scp sur le nouveau serveur et tu importes avec zcat NOM_DE_BASE.sql.gz | mysql -uUSER -pPASSWORD NOM_DE_NOUVELLE_BASE en remplaçant USER et PASSWORD bien sûr. Lien vers le commentaire Partager sur d’autres sites More sharing options...
Khleo Posté 21 Avril 2008 Auteur Partager Posté 21 Avril 2008 Ca fonctionne avec une limitation de taille ou c'est sans limite ? Lien vers le commentaire Partager sur d’autres sites More sharing options...
Leonick Posté 21 Avril 2008 Partager Posté 21 Avril 2008 Ca dépend la limite qui t'aura été assignée au niveau des répertoires de mysql Lien vers le commentaire Partager sur d’autres sites More sharing options...
Sujets conseillés
Veuillez vous connecter pour commenter
Vous pourrez laisser un commentaire après vous êtes connecté.
Connectez-vous maintenant